Gemma, just a little tip for when you arrive. Whenever I have booked car hire at Palma I have left wife to get the bags etc and I have hurried off to the car hire desc to beat the quews ( as do many others) by the time paperwork is done wife arrives with bags and all is well. However Villa Parade are using Avis and on arrival at the desk inside the arrival hall you are sent over to the main carpark to complete the paperwork. No problem except when wife arrives at the terminal desk you are nowhere to be seen and as its not possible to get back into the arrival area you end up being split apart and having to look for each other.( NOT EASY ON A BUSY sATURDAY). If you know this its easy to sort , but can be a bit stressfull if your not aware. Hope u have a great holiday.
 
here is another little tip tip from the opposite of tombadino.Whenever i have booked a villa with hired car i make sure i am one of the last people the car hire company deal with because on a couple of occassions all the basic models have been taken and they give you whats left usually a far better car without any additional charge.Lat year we were lucky enough to get an air conditioned Renault Megaine for the two weeks.

To speed things along you should also have your credit card handy (deposit and petrol payment), your drivers licence (some also require the paper 'part'), your passport, and it is handy to have your destination address and mobile number written down on a piece of paper or your rental confirmation voucher as most of the hire car companies require this information.
